#6deab5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6deab5 is composed of 42.7% red, 91.8%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.6%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 154.6 degrees, a saturation of 74.9% and a lightness of 67.3%. #6deab5 color hex could be obtained by blending #daffff with #00d56b.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#6deab5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010805 is the darkest color, while #f6fefb is the lightest one.
